MatLab数字图像处理初步

实验一 MATLAB数字图像处理初步

一、实验目的与要求

1. 熟悉并掌握在MATLAB中能够处理的图像类型。

2. 熟练掌握在MATLAB中如何读取图像。

3. 掌握利用MATLAB获取图像的大小、颜色、高度、宽度等相关信息。

4. 掌握在MATLAB中按照指定要求存储一幅图像。

5. 掌握图像间的转化。

二、实验设备与软件

(1) PC计算机系统

(2) MATLAB软件,包括图像处理工具箱(Image Processing Toolbox)

(3) 实验图片

三、实验原理及知识点

1、数字图像的表示和类别

一幅图像可以被定义为一个二维函数f(x,y),其中x和y是空间(平面)坐标,f在坐标(x,y)处的振幅称为图像在该点的亮度。灰度是用来表示黑白图像亮度的一个术语,而彩色图像是由若干个二维图像组合形成的。例如,在RGB彩色系统中,一幅彩色图像是由三幅独立的分量图像(红、绿、蓝)组成的。因此,许多为黑白图像处理开发的技术也适用于彩色图像处理,方法是分别处理三幅独立的分量图像即可。

图像关于x和y坐标以及振幅连续。要将这样的一幅图像转化为数字形式,就要求数字化坐标和振幅。将坐标值数字化称为取样,将振幅数字化称为量化。采样和量化的过程如图1所示。因此,当f的x、y分量和振幅都是有限且离散的量时,称该图像为数字图像。

作为MATLAB基本数据类型的数组十分适于表达图像,矩阵的元素和图像的像素之间有着十分自然的对应关系。

图1 图像的采样和量化

实验1 matlab图像处理初步,1.实验一 MatLab数字图像处理初步相关推荐

  1. 《数字图像处理》读书笔记2:数字图像处理基础

    <数字图像处理>读书笔记2:数字图像处理基础 1 人类视觉感知 1.1 眼睛构造图 1.2 基本概念: 1.2.1 亮度适应(Brightness Adaptation) 1.2.2 主观 ...

  2. 计算机科学与技术图像处理,《计算机科学与技术:数字图像处理》李俊山、李旭辉 编_孔网...

    <计算机科学与技术:数字图像处理>较全面地介绍了数字图像处理的基本概念.基本原理.基本技术和基本方法.全书正文有10章,内容包括绪论.数字图像处理基础.图像变换.图像增强.图像恢复.图像压 ...

  3. 数字图像处理与python实现 pdf_正版 数字图像处理与Python实现 高等院校计算机科学 人工智能 信号与信息处理 通信工程等专业的...

    第 1章 数字图像处理基础知识 1.1 数字图像简介 1.1.1 数字图像处理的目的 1.1.2 数字图像处理的应用 1.1.3 数字图像处理特点 1.1.4 常见的数字图像处理方法 1.2 图像采样 ...

  4. 【数字图像处理之(一)】数字图像处理与相关领域概述

    数字图像(Digital Image) 一副图像可以定义为一个 二维函数f(x, y),这里的x和y是空间坐标,而在任意坐标(x, y)处的幅度f被称为这一坐标位置图像的亮度或灰度.当x.y和f的幅值 ...

  5. 数字图像处理学习笔记(六)——数字图像处理中用到的数学操作

    数字图像处理(Digital Image Processing)是通过计算机对图像进行去除噪声.增强.复原.分割.提取特征等处理的方法和技术.本专栏将以学习笔记形式对数字图像处理的重点基础知识进行总结 ...

  6. matlab图像处理课程设计,基于MATLAB_GUI的数字图像处理程序设计课程设计

    k=medfilt2(handles.noise_img);%中值滤波 k=wiener2(handles.noise_img,[5,5]);%自适应滤波 k=filter2(fspecial('av ...

  7. 数字图像处理吴娱课后答案_数字图像处理课后题答案

    1. 图像处理的主要方法分几大类 ? 答:图字图像处理方法分为大两类:空间域处理(空域法)和变换域处理(频域法) . 空域法:直接对获取的数字图像进行处理. 频域法:对先对获取的数字图像进行正交变换, ...

  8. matlab数字图像处理课程设计报告,数字图像处理课程设计实验报告.doc

    数字图像处理课程设计实验报告 数字图像处理课程设计 题 目:数字图像处理及Huufman(或小波变换)编码仿真实现 学生姓名: 学 院:信息工程学院 系 别:电子信息工程系 专 业:电子信息工程 班 ...

  9. MATLAB数字图像处理系统-形状分类

    MATLAB数字图像处理系统-形状分类 摘 要 数字图像处理是一门新兴技术,随着计算机硬件的发展,数字图像的实时处理已经成为可能,由于数字图像处理的各种算法的出现,使得其处理速度越来越快,能更好的为人 ...

  10. 数字图像处理matlab实践

    目录 一.任务描述 3 二.设计思路 3 三.功能模块 3 1 图像灰度化 3 2 图像二值化 4 3 图像叠加 5 4 图像目标检测 5 5 图像对数变换 6 6 图像指数变换 7 7 图像直方图均 ...

最新文章

  1. 浅谈inode和block与磁盘性能的初级优化
  2. 包r语言_R语言代码共享:制作R包
  3. python with函数的用法(with expression [as target])
  4. iOS 关于枚举的使用
  5. 电脑w ndows无法自动修复,windows 10自动修复无法修复你的电脑
  6. 微信墙服务器地址,一面微信墙的诞生(3) 用户端界面的创建
  7. 5种iterator
  8. php有没有dao层,php框架开发四(DAO层)_PHP教程
  9. Linux电源管理(3)-Generic PM之reboot过程【转】
  10. SLAM方向国内有哪些优秀公司?
  11. 软件工程——软件开发过程中用到的各种图
  12. 考研数学 第7讲 零点问题和微分不定式
  13. python计算累计收益率的函数_大盘及策略收益率的公式推导与Python代码
  14. 售价6815万元,95后加密艺术家推出“Dream Chaser”NFT系列作品
  15. Ubuntu安装Lua
  16. 【工具】OmniGraffle 激活码、UML模板型版
  17. 数据库系统从挂科到满分【精华再精华的数据库系统基础理论】1
  18. 可怕的乖孩子_你知道乖孩子的一生,有多可怕吗?
  19. BLDC的速度闭环控制
  20. 免费地图下载流量如何领取?

热门文章

  1. Cisco 计算机网络课程设计 某校园网设计
  2. live2d碰撞_Unity Live2D 模型(与UI)拖拽功能 实现源码
  3. 如何在家优雅地使用 Sci-Hub 免费下载外文文献
  4. 打印机共享与文件夹win10共享教程
  5. 队列的实现(C语言版)
  6. cad缩小了怎么还原_CAD的窗口突然不能缩小了怎么回事,应该怎么恢复
  7. 声反馈(啸叫)如何避免产生和解决
  8. 已知文件url,批量下载文件
  9. 计算机视觉专业名词中英文对照
  10. python培训教程 ppt